Class ConnectionCacheFactory
- java.lang.Object
-
- com.sun.xml.ws.transport.tcp.connectioncache.spi.transport.ConnectionCacheFactory
-
public final class ConnectionCacheFactory extends Object
A factory class for creating connections caches. Note that a rather unusual syntax is needed for calling these methods:ConnectionCacheFactory.<V>makeXXXCache()This is required because the type variable V is not used in the parameters of the factory method (there are no parameters).
-
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static <C extends Connection>
InboundConnectionCache<C>makeBlockingInboundConnectionCache(String cacheType, int highWaterMark, int numberToReclaim, Logger logger)static <C extends Connection>
OutboundConnectionCache<C>makeBlockingOutboundConnectionCache(String cacheType, int highWaterMark, int numberToReclaim, int maxParallelConnections, Logger logger)
-
-
-
Method Detail
-
makeBlockingOutboundConnectionCache
public static <C extends Connection> OutboundConnectionCache<C> makeBlockingOutboundConnectionCache(String cacheType, int highWaterMark, int numberToReclaim, int maxParallelConnections, Logger logger)
-
makeBlockingInboundConnectionCache
public static <C extends Connection> InboundConnectionCache<C> makeBlockingInboundConnectionCache(String cacheType, int highWaterMark, int numberToReclaim, Logger logger)
-
-